WATERSIDE WORKERS

AND FEDERATION OF LABOR I WARNING TO MEMBERS. PBESS ASSOCIATION. WANGANUI, July 23. A meeting of delegates of tho New Zealand Federation of Waterside AVorkers wes held in Wanganui to-day to consider stops foi* strengthening tho federation. Thero were present—Messrs Burrows and McCarthy (representing NapTer nnd Gisborne), Hayward (Bluff), Smith (Wanganui). also the following members of the executive: —Messrs Seal, Callaghan. Dorn ucll, AVhito, Mandono, and G. McKajr. Tlie secretary’s report regretted that out of twelve unions a year ago only four— Napier, Bluff, Gisborne, and Wanganui —now remained loyal to the federation, the rest having gone over to tho Federation of Labor. Mr J. Reed, president of the New Zealand AA'aterside AA’orkers’ Federation, wrote from Lyttelton regretting the turn events h.id taken, and warning other federations of unions from being split up by tho Federation of Labor, which was making but little progress in the right direction, and only dividing a house against itself.
